I have a Western Digital 120gb sata that isn't being recognised by the bios. The motherboard is an asus k8v. I have just a regular 4 pin molex hooked up to it, i was thinking that maybe having a sata power connector would make it work, but i don't know what's up.
 
i have a k8v se deluxe with a WD 120GB HD and it works fine

Have you installed windows/drivers for it?

Also if you have just the K8V model and not SE or deluxe...maybe a bios flash with a newer version could help?

I also have the 4pin molex hooked up to it...you don't need the SATA power
 
the drive works, and i am trying to install windows on it, but windows doesn't recognize it either so it won't install on it. It's the K8V deluxe.
 
Use the SATA Driver diskette that came with your mobo. Or an individual controller, if thats what u have!
 
go to ASUS's website

click download

go to your motherboard

download ALL of the drivers related to SATA drives

and when you try to install windows insert all 3 disks

and it should work fine:)
